Start with the problem, never the technology
The single most common mistake is starting from the technology. Someone sees a demo, gets excited, and goes looking for a place to put it. That is backwards, and it is why so many AI projects die as pilots.
Start from the work instead. Walk through your business and look for two things: places where people spend a lot of time on repetitive judgment, and places where better or faster decisions would move real money. AI earns its keep in exactly those spots. Everything else is a science project.
A simple prompt that surfaces good candidates: "Where does my team do the same kind of thinking over and over, and where would being faster or more accurate change a number the CFO cares about?"
Make a longlist, then be ruthless
Get every idea out of people's heads and onto one list. Talk to the people doing the actual work, not just the leadership. The best use cases usually come from the person drowning in the task, not the person describing it in a strategy meeting.
Do not filter yet. You want breadth first. Twenty to forty candidates is normal for a mid-sized company.
Score every candidate on two axes
Now you get ruthless. Score each use case on two things, one to five.
Value. If this worked well, how much would it be worth? Think in real terms: hours saved per week, revenue influenced, risk reduced, customers retained. Be honest. Most ideas are a two.
Feasibility. Can you actually build this soon? Feasibility is mostly about data and clarity, not model cleverness. Do you have the data, is it accessible, is it clean enough, and is the task well defined? A brilliant idea sitting on data nobody can reach is a zero.
Multiply the two, or plot them on a simple grid. The winners are the ones that are both valuable and feasible. High value and low feasibility goes on the roadmap for later. Low value gets cut, no matter how exciting the technology is.
A quick scoring template
| Use case | Value (1-5) | Feasibility (1-5) | Score | Notes |
|---|---|---|---|---|
| Auto-draft support replies | 4 | 4 | 16 | Clean ticket history, clear task |
| Predict churn | 5 | 2 | 10 | Data scattered, needs cleanup first |
| Generate marketing images | 2 | 5 | 10 | Easy, but low business value |
Copy this, fill it with your real candidates, and the shortlist writes itself.
Pick one and pressure-test it
Resist the urge to start three. Pick the single highest-scoring use case and pressure-test it before you build.
Ask four questions. Who exactly will use this, and will they change how they work to adopt it? What does "good enough to be useful" look like, concretely? What data does it need, and do we have it today? And how will we know in a month whether it worked?
If you cannot answer those, you have not found a use case yet. You have found a wish. Go back to the list.
Build a working MVP, not a slide
This is where most consultancies hand you a deck and leave. Do the opposite. Build the smallest version of the thing that a real person can actually use, and put it in front of them.
An MVP is not a prototype that lives in a demo. It is a narrow, working slice that survives contact with reality. It will be rough. That is fine. The goal is a real signal from real usage, because that signal is worth more than any amount of planning.
If it works, you expand it. If it does not, you have learned that cheaply and you move to the next candidate on your scored list. Either way you are ahead.
Common mistakes to avoid
Chasing the shiny use case because it demos well. Boiling the ocean by starting five things at once. Ignoring the data reality until you are halfway in. Building for a user who never agreed to change their workflow. And treating a pilot as the finish line instead of the starting line.
Every one of these ends the same way: an impressive proof of concept that never becomes a product.

Frequently asked questions
How many AI use cases should we start with? One. Score your whole list, pick the highest-value, most-feasible candidate, and get it into production before you start a second.
What makes an AI use case feasible? Mostly data and clarity. You need accessible, reasonably clean data and a well-defined task. Model choice matters far less than people expect.
How long should an AI MVP take? Weeks, not quarters. If your first useful version is a year away, the use case is too broad. Narrow it until a working slice is close.
What is the difference between a pilot and an MVP? A pilot proves the idea can work. An MVP is a working slice real users actually use. Aim for the second, because usage is the only honest signal.
